Timmins continues to be paying the most at the pumps in Northern Ontario.
At 165.2 cents per litre, the price of gas is a couple of cents cheaper than last week, but it's still seven cents more expensive than other northern cities, with Sudbury being the second most expensive at 158.2 cents per litre.
